Notes for Henry Redfield: Henry resided at Rodney, Mississippi, removed thence to Carthage, Louisiana. Married first June 12, 1814 to Meriam or Marion Chappel, b. Sept.12, 1797 in Onandaga, N.Y. She died Mar.1, 1835 and he remarried on Feb. 16, 1836 Julia Ann Elliot Cole, dau. of Wm. and Ruth Elliot. He died Dec. 23, 1844 in his 51st year. ( His brother says that two of Henry's sons were killed in the Mexican War. )
Henry Redfield was enumerated in the Eighth U. S. Census taken in 1840 of the Louisiana Parrish of Concordia. Listed were one male each: Under 5 (James b. 11-16-1838), 5 under 10 (Sidney b. 2-28-1832), 10 under15 (Wm. Wesley b. 3-20-1826), 15 under 20 (Henry b. 9-21-1824), 20 under 30 (Richard Curtis b. 1-3-1820), and 40 under 50 (Henry b. 3-24-1794); two females 10 under 15 (must have been Julia Ann's by marriage with Cole), and one 30 under 40 (Julia Ann b. 3-12-1810). The data within (-----) are mine obtained from other sources.
